According to the perennial wisdom teachings, your vocation is not a means of survival in the world – it is a pure expression of your life force. Vocation arises, not as a response to external forces, but authentically from within your own body. To the modern mind, this approach to work sounds radical. But for more than 3,000 years, sacred traditions in the East and West have allowed vocation to serve as a platform for spiritual and material growth. The Ultimate Anticareer Guide is the first audio curriculum that adapts this classic approach to right livelihood to the challenges unique to our place and time. Based on the national anticareer workshops taught by Dr. Rick Jarow since 1988, this is the same life-changing program that has helped thousands of frustrated job seekers open to their intuition, transform their values into action, and answer their true calling – instead of settling for a paycheck. Traditional career strategies are simply reactions to the job market; Dr. Jarow begins – for example, matching an inventory of skills with the want ads. An “anticareer” is a manifestation of the unique blueprint for your destiny encoded in your body since birth. The key to this revolutionary approach is your body’s chakra system; the seven centers that govern the free flow of prana, or life force, through your body. Through a program of powerful meditations, you gain direct access to your chakras, clearing and aligning them with the energetic forces that make everything in life possible. You don’t have to go out looking for a job, Dr. Jarow says. The job you were born to do will unfold in time, like a tree from a seed, as you let go of self-limiting concepts and open to the energy of creation – with The Ultimate Anticareer Guide.
In one of the most powerful and genuine audios on any subject, a spiritual seeker and career expert applies a wide array of personal growth knowledge to the challenge of finding one's life work. This is an exceptional guide that jumps right over the truisms of career counseling and job hunting and grabs you where you are with your life. Jarow faultlessly integrates his experience with Eastern thought and the psychology of work to provide beautifully articulated advice and powerful meditation exercises. Though some of the guidance is for people who function in large organizations, his focus is on respect for one's artistic talents and on functioning ethically in the world. Much of the presentation is grounded in the chakras, which are explained with as much emotional clarity as anything I've ever heard on the subject. The program is worth every penny. T.W. Winner of AudioFile Earphones Award (c) AudioFile 2002, Portland, Maine
About the Creator
Rick Jarow is a professor of history of religious studies at Vassar College, a former Mellon Fellow in the Humanities, Columbia University, practicing alternative career counselor. His popular Anti-Career Workshop, which has been offered internationally, is based on years of research and practice with lineage holders in both Eastern and Western traditions. Rick Jarow is the author of In Search of the Sacred; and Creating the Work You Love: Courage, Commitment, and Career.
